The LEGO Group offers unique and challenging career opportunities in a global organization founded on fun, creativity and innovation. The name 'LEGO' is an abbreviation of the two Danish words "leg godt",
meaning "play well". And that has been our guideline since 1932. Today, LEGO Group is the world’s largest manufacturer in construction toys and LEGO products are sold in more than 130 countries. Our head office is in Billund, Denmark, and we have subsidiaries and branches throughout the world.

The LEGO Brand Retail Stores are designed to create an environment where creativity and imagination define the future of play. Through our interactive guest experience, which include LEGO club meetings,
free monthly mini builds, birthday parties, in-store play, and Design by Me, LEGO Brand Retail strives to foster relationships with our guests that transcend generations and are as timeless as the products we
sell.
